Abstract
The invention discloses a kind of fixture for motor case processing, and it is carried out face clamping to the motor stator in motor case, to fix motor, is processed with the end face to motor case.The present invention can avoid motor stator from being supportted rising, so as to avoid motor case from being deformed.
Description
Technical field
The present invention relates to a kind of fixture for motor case processing.
Background technology
When being processed to motor, after motor stator is assembled in motor case, it is necessary to the two of motor case
End processing seam, in order to the assembling between electric motor end cap and motor case., it is necessary to first enter motor case before seam is processed
Luggage is clamping fixed, then carries out Milling Process to the end face of motor case again so that process seam in the end face of motor case.
Typically motor case is fixed to support the motor stator that rises by inner support clamp at present, and inner support clamp is supportted motor stator
When rising, slight deformation will occur for motor stator, so that slight deformation will occur for motor case, so as to influence motor machine
Assembling between shell and electric motor end cap.
The content of the invention
The technical problem to be solved by the invention is to provide a kind of fixture for motor case processing, it can be avoided
Motor stator, which is supportted, to rise, so as to avoid motor case from being deformed.
In order to solve the above technical problems, provided by the present invention for the fixture of motor case processing, it includes:
One frame;
One locating shaft, locating shaft are horizontally disposed with, and one end of locating shaft is fixedly connected with frame, and axial direction is provided with locating shaft
The centre bore of insertion, a radial convex loop is provided with the periphery wall of locating shaft, the external diameter of locating shaft is less than motor machine to be processed
The aperture of the stator inner hole of motor stator in shell, locating shaft are used for the motor stator extending into motor case to be processed
In stator inner hole, radial convex loop is used to offset with the first end face of the motor stator in motor case to be processed;
One telescopic shaft, telescopic shaft activity are located in the centre bore of locating shaft, one end end of the remote frame of telescopic shaft
Threaded connection post is provided with, threaded connection post is coaxially set with telescopic shaft;
One cylinder, cylinder are arranged in frame, for driving telescopic shaft axial stretching;
One pressing plate, pressing plate are ring-type, pressing plate be used for activity be nested with one end of the remote frame of telescopic shaft and with it is to be processed
Motor case in the second end face of motor stator offset;
One nut, nut are used to be threaded on threaded connection post and offseted with a surface of pressing plate.
As an improvement, when the first end face of the motor stator in bulge loop and motor case to be processed offsets, screw thread connects
Post is connect to be entirely located in motor case to be processed.
After above structure, the present invention compared with prior art, has the following advantages that:
When processing motor, motor stator is assembled in motor case and fixed, motor stator is then nested with positioning
On axle, and the first end face of radial convex loop and motor stator is offseted, then pressing plate is nested with telescopic shaft, and cause pressure
One surface of plate and the second end face of motor stator offset, and so, radial convex loop and pressing plate just clamp motor stator, then will
Nut is screwed on threaded connection post, and another surface of nut and pressing plate offsets, and then starts cylinder, and the expansion link of cylinder returns
Contracting, telescopic shaft retraction is driven, telescopic shaft drives nut synchronizing moving, and nut promotes axle of the pressing plate along telescopic shaft in movement
Line direction is moved, and pressing plate compresses motor stator to the direction of radial convex loop, and so, pressing plate and radial convex loop are just by motor stator
It is fixedly clamped, is fixed so as to also allow for motor case, then can processes seam to the end face of motor case;Using the present invention
During fixing motor case, motor stator will not be caused by and supportted the situation for rising and motor stator being deformed, also would not
Cause the deformation of motor case, it is ensured that motor case normally assembles with end cap.
And when the first end face of the motor stator in bulge loop and motor case to be processed offsets, threaded connection post is complete
Portion is located in motor case to be processed, so, when being processed using milling cutter to the end face of motor case, telescopic shaft
Motor case is not stretched out with threaded connection post, so as to avoid because telescopic shaft and threaded connection post stretch out in motor case
And the movement of milling cutter is influenceed, to ensure being normally carried out for Milling Process.

Embodiment
The present invention is described in more detail with reference to the accompanying drawings and detailed description.
As shown in Fig. 1, Fig. 2, the fixture that the present invention is used for motor case processing is stretched including a frame 1, a locating shaft 2, one
Contracting axle 3, a cylinder 4, a pressing plate 5 and a nut 6.
Locating shaft 2 is horizontally disposed, and one end of locating shaft 2 is fixedly connected with frame 1, be provided with locating shaft 2 axially through
Centre bore, be provided with a radial convex loop 201, the other end end face of locating shaft 2 and radial convex loop on the periphery wall of locating shaft 2
The distance between 201 are less than the axial length of motor stator, and the external diameter of locating shaft 2 is less than the motor in motor case to be processed
The aperture of the stator inner hole of stator, locating shaft 2 are used for the stator inner hole for the motor stator extending into motor case to be processed
In, radial convex loop 201 is used to offset with the first end face 7 of the motor stator in motor case to be processed.
The activity of telescopic shaft 3 is located in the centre bore of locating shaft 2, and one end end set of the remote frame 1 of telescopic shaft 3 has
Post 301 is threadedly coupled, threaded connection post 301 is coaxially set with telescopic shaft 3.
Cylinder 4 is arranged in frame 1, for driving the axial stretching of telescopic shaft 3.
Pressing plate 5 is ring-type, pressing plate 5 be used for activity be nested with one end of the remote frame 1 of telescopic shaft 3 and with electricity to be processed
The second end face 8 of motor stator in machine casing offsets.
Nut 6 is used to be threaded on threaded connection post 301 and offseted with a surface of pressing plate 5, when the screw thread of nut 6 connects
When being connected on threaded connection post 301, nut 6 and the threaded connection axial limiting of post 301 so that nut 6 and telescopic shaft 3 are in axial side
Sync up movement.
When the first end face 7 of the motor stator in bulge loop 201 and motor case to be processed offsets, post is threadedly coupled
301 are entirely located in motor case to be processed, and when the present invention fixes motor case, the first end face of motor case is close to machine
Then frame 1, the second end face of motor case are processed in the second end face of motor case using milling cutter and stopped away from frame 1
Mouthful, because now telescopic shaft and threaded connection post do not stretch out the second end face of motor case, so as to avoid due to flexible
Axle and threaded connection post stretch out in motor case and influence the movement of milling cutter.
